The Nigerian Defence Academy has raised the alarm over fraudsters impersonating its Commandant, Oluyemi Olatoye, to dupe unsuspecting Nigerians online.
According to NDA spokesperson Reuben Kovangiya, scammers are using platforms like Facebook, LinkedIn, TikTok, Instagram, and X to push fake contract offers and lure victims.
The Academy made it clear: these accounts are fraudulent and any engagement is at your own risk.
“The Commandant does not conduct official business via personal social media,” Kovangiya stressed, adding that all legitimate communication comes only through verified NDA channels and recognised media outlets.
The warning comes amid rising online scams targeting individuals with promises of lucrative deals.
